finnas Gold Donating Members 105 Member For: 15y 29d Posted 06/04/20 02:58 PM Author Share Posted 06/04/20 02:58 PM So looking back over the journey it all comes down to goals and expectations. Do do you want a car with a 10sec timeslip? Do you just want a car that’s fast up to legal speeds? Etc etc The baby GTX still going strong. Recently pulled it all down to see how the shaft play is etc. Still none like new. The car has never been on a dyno. Results from running it at the motorplex: on 98 - 11.78 @ 121mph 1.96 60ft on e85 - 11.86 @ 124mph 2.1 60ft Biggest issue you’ll have is traction as you can see. As soon as I got the gtx in I bought new rims to fit 275s on the rear. With out them the car was dangerous. With e85 the car is still dangerous. But it’s all good fun. I digress. If you wanna run a 10 get a 3582 gtx. If your car doesn’t do it on 98 it definitely will on e85. For me, my goal was to have a decent street car, it’s my daily, had it from new. It does 0-100 in 4.4secs and 100-200 in another 7.4. Trying to max this thing out to run a 10 is gonna end up in 1000s with either busted shafts or in driveline and tyres to get a 1.6 60ft. For those interested in boost and timing. I was fairly conservative. 98: 16->12psi and 8* -> 11* e85: 18->15psi and 15*->17* What I’ve ended up with is a pretty mental daily and pretty much what I wanted out of it. Not gonna lie, a low 11 would have been nice but the traction is there at the motorplex and I ain’t buying ETs to run a time 😂 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
